7.8 Channel Status Settings

Use the Channel Status screen to scan WiFi channel noises and view the results. Click Network Setting >
Wireless > Channel Status. The screen appears as shown. Click Scan to scan the WiFi channels. You can
view the results in the Channel Scan Result section.

DESCRIPTION
For 2.4 GHz frequency WiFi devices:
Select 802.11b Only to allow only IEEE 802.11b compliant WiFi devices to associate with the
WX Device.
Select 802.11g Only to allow only IEEE 802.11g compliant WiFi devices to associate with the
WX Device.
Select 802.11n Only to allow only IEEE 802.11n compliant WiFi devices to associate with the
WX Device.
Select 802.11b/g Mixed to allow either IEEE 802.11b or IEEE 802.11g compliant WiFi devices
to associate with the WX Device. The transmission rate of your WX Device might be
reduced.
Select 802.11b/g/n Mixed to allow IEEE 802.11b, IEEE 802.11g or IEEE 802.11n compliant WiFi
devices to associate with the WX Device. The transmission rate of your WX Device might be
reduced.
Select 802.11b/g/n/ax Mixed to allow IEEE 802.11b, IEEE 802.11g, IEEE 802.11n or IEEE
802.11ax compliant WiFi devices to associate with the WX Device. The transmission rate of
your WX Device might be reduced.
For 5 GHz frequency WiFi devices:
Select 802.11a Only to allow only IEEE 802.11a compliant WiFi devices to associate with the
WX Device.
Select 802.11n Only to allow only IEEE 802.11n compliant WiFi devices to associate with the
WX Device.
Select 802.11ac Only to allow only IEEE 802.11ac compliant WiFi devices to associate with
the WX Device.
Select 802.11a/n Mixed to allow either IEEE 802.11a or IEEE 802.11n compliant WiFi devices
to associate with the WX Device. The transmission rate of your WX Device might be
reduced.
Select 802.11n/ac Mixed to allow either IEEE 802.11n or IEEE 802.11ac compliant WiFi
devices to associate with the WX Device. The transmission rate of your WX Device might be
reduced.
Select 802.11a/n/ac Mixed to allow IEEE 802.11a, IEEE 802.11n or IEEE 802.11ac compliant
WiFi devices to associate with the WX Device. The transmission rate of your WX Device might
be reduced.
Select 802.11a/n/ac/ax Mixed to allow IEEE 802.11a, IEEE 802.11n, IEEE 802.11ac or IEEE
802.11ax compliant WiFi devices to associate with the WX Device. The transmission rate of
your WX Device might be reduced.
For 6 GHz frequency WiFi devices:
Select 802.11ax Only to allow only IEEE 802.11ax compliant WiFi devices to associate with
the WX Device.
This option is only available when using WPA2-PSK as the Security Mode and AES Encryption in
Network Setting > Wireless > General. Management frame protection (MFP) helps prevent WiFi
DoS attacks.
Select Disable if you do not want to use MFP.
Select Capable to encrypt management frames of WiFi clients that support MFP. Clients that do
not support MFP will still be allowed to join the WiFi network, but remain unprotected.
Select Required to allow only clients that support MFP to join the WiFi network.
Click Cancel to restore the default or previously saved settings.
Click Apply to save your changes.
